Official Journal of the European Union

C 395/2

(Case C-114/12) (*)

((Action for annulment - External action of the European Union - International agreements - Protection of neighbouring rights of broadcasting organisations - Negotiations for a Convention of the Council of Europe - Decision of the Council and the Representatives of the Governments of the Member States authorising the joint participation of the Union and its Member States in the negotiations - Article 3(2) TFEU - Exclusive external competence of the Union))

(2014/C 395/02)

Language of the case: English

Parties

Applicant: European Commission (represented by: F. Castillo de la Torre, P. Hetsch, L. Gussetti and J. Samnadda, Agents)

Intervener in support of the applicant: European Parliament (represented by: R. Passos and D. Warin, Agents)

Defendant: Council of the European Union (represented by: H. Legal, J.-P. Hix, F. Florindo Gijón and M. Balta, Agents)

Interveners in support of the defendant: Czech Republic (represented by: M. Smolek, E. Ruffer, D. Hadroušek and J. Králová, Agents), Federal Republic of Germany (represented by: T. Henze, B. Beutler and N. Graf Vitzthum, Agents), Kingdom of the Netherlands (represented by: C. Wissels and J. Langer, Agents), Republic of Poland (represented by: M. Szpunar, B. Majczyna, M. Drwięcki and E. Gromnicka initially, then by B. Majczyna, M. Drwięcki and E. Gromnicka, Agents), United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land (represented by: C. Murrell, acting as Agent, assisted by R. Palmer, Barrister)

Operative part

The Court:

1)Annuls the Decision of the Council and the Representatives of the Governments of the Member States meeting within the Council on the participation of the European Union and its Member States in negotiations for a Convention of the Council of Europe on the protection of the rights of broadcasting organisations, of 19 December 2011;

2)Orders the Council of the European Union to pay the costs;

3)Orders the Czech Republic, the Federal Republic of Germany, the Kingdom of the Netherlands, the Republic of Poland, the United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land and the European Parliament to bear their own costs.
